About

Nadav Sorek is a scholar working on Plant Science, Molecular Biology and Biochem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Nadav Sorek has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 974 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Plant Science, 9 papers in Molecular Biology and 3 papers in Biochemistry. Recurrent topics in Nadav Sorek’s work include Plant Molecular Biology Research (6 papers),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(5 papers) and Lipid metabolism and biosynthesis (3 papers). Nadav Sorek is often cited by papers focused on Plant Molecular Biology Research (6 papers),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(5 papers) and Lipid metabolism and biosynthesis (3 papers). Nadav Sorek collaborates with scholars based in Israel, United States and Germany. Nadav Sorek's co-authors include Shaul Yalovsky, Daria Bloch, Stefanie Schültke, Oliver Batistič, Jörg Kudla, Benedikt Kost, Limor Poraty, Trevor H. Yeats, Chris Somerville and Hasana Sternberg and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, The Plant Cell and Molecular and Cellular Biology.
